git拉取远程代码冲突解决方法
时间: 2024-05-06 20:11:39 浏览: 9
当你在拉取远程代码时,如果本地代码与远程代码有冲突,可以按照以下步骤解决:
1. 首先使用 `git fetch` 命令获取远程代码的最新版本,但不会自动合并到本地代码中。
2. 然后使用 `git status` 命令查看当前分支的状态,看看是否有冲突。
3. 如果有冲突,使用 `git diff` 命令查看冲突的文件,找到冲突的地方。
4. 手动修改冲突的文件,将代码合并到一起。
5. 修改完成后,使用 `git add` 命令将修改后的文件添加到暂存区。
6. 最后使用 `git commit` 命令提交修改。
相关问题
git 拉取代码冲突解决
git拉取代码冲突解决的步骤如下:首先,可以使用git diff命令查看冲突的文件和冲突的内容。然后,可以使用git stash命令将本地修改暂存起来,以便后续恢复。接下来,可以使用git pull命令拉取远程代码,此时可能会出现冲突。使用git diff -w命令来确认代码自动合并的情况,并作出相应修改。在解决冲突的文件中,"Updated upstream"和"====="之间的内容是拉取下来的代码,"====="和"stashed changes"之间的内容是本地修改的代码。完成冲突解决后,可以使用git add命令将修改的文件添加到缓存区,然后使用git commit命令提交修改。最后,可以使用git stash drop命令删除stash,如果不加stash编号,默认删除最新的stash。如果需要清空整个git栈,可以使用git stash clear命令。
git拉取远程代码到本地idea
要在本地IDEA中拉取远程代码,您可以按照以下步骤操作:
1. 首先,确保您已经在本地安装了Git,并且已经在IDEA中配置了Git相关设置。
2. 打开IDEA,并导航到顶部菜单栏中的"VCS"选项。然后选择"Git",再选择"Pull"。
3. 在弹出的对话框中,输入远程仓库的URL。根据您提供的引用,URL可能类似于"http://192.167.183.127:1234/r/s/url1.git"。
4. 确认URL无误后,点击"Pull"按钮来拉取远程仓库的代码到本地。
以上是基本的拉取远程代码的步骤。然而,如果您的本地代码有未提交的更改,您可能需要先将这些更改暂存起来,然后再拉取远程代码并合并。
根据您提供的引用[1]和引用,您可以执行以下操作来实现这个过程:
1. 使用"git stash"命令将本地未提交的更改暂存起来,以便稍后恢复。
2. 执行"git pull"命令来拉取远程代码并合并到本地。
3. 如果在合并过程中出现冲突,您需要手动解决冲突。您可以使用IDEA的合并工具来辅助解决冲突。
4. 解决冲突后,使用"git commit"命令来提交合并后的更改。
通过执行上述步骤,您就可以将远程代码拉取到本地IDEA中,并与本地代码进行合并。请注意,具体操作可能会因您的项目和Git配置而有所不同,上述步骤仅供参考。<span class="em">1</span><span class="em">2</span><span class="em">3</span>
#### 引用[.reference_title]
- *1* [git拉取代码和临时存储空间使用](https://download.csdn.net/download/xiaoyao20102/10631433)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v93^chatsearchT3_2"}}] [.reference_item style="max-width: 33.333333333333336%"]
- *2* [Git](https://blog.csdn.net/m0_38064463/article/details/103251432)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v93^chatsearchT3_2"}}] [.reference_item style="max-width: 33.333333333333336%"]
- *3* [git:拉取源代码到idea上](https://blog.csdn.net/weixin_45730125/article/details/125636967)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v93^chatsearchT3_2"}}] [.reference_item style="max-width: 33.333333333333336%"]
[ .reference_list ]